About OSCYX

The Invesco Main Street Small Cap Fund Class Y is an open-end mutual fund focused on capital appreciation through investments in U.S. small-cap companies. Its strategy centers on identifying growth and value opportunities among firms within the smallest segment of the U.S. equity market, typically targeting those in the bottom 10% by market capitalization. The fund employs a blend approach, holding a diversified mix of both growth and value stocks across sectors such as health care, consumer discretionary, financials, industrials, and information technology. Notably, its portfolio is less concentrated in its top holdings compared to the category average, which enhances diversification within the asset class. With a history dating back to 2013, the fund has consistently garnered high ratings for its risk-adjusted returns and for maintaining performance resilience across varying market cycles. This asset plays a key role for investors seeking diversified exposure to U.S. small-cap equities, serving as a vehicle to participate in the dynamic growth potential and sector diversity that characterizes this market segment.
